Understanding the Lumper Job Description

The job description of a lumper can vary slightly depending on the industry and the specific employer. However, there are several core responsibilities that are common across most lumper jobs.

At its core, a lumper's job involves manual labor, requiring them to lift, move, and load/unload cargo. They often use equipment like forklifts, pallet jacks, and dollies to facilitate this process. However, their role extends beyond physical labor. Lumpers are also responsible for maintaining the cleanliness and organization of the workspace, ensuring that safety protocols are followed, and sometimes even performing basic equipment maintenance.

Physical Demands of a Lumper Job

Lumping jobs are physically demanding. Lumpers are required to lift heavy objects, often weighing up to 50 pounds or more. They spend their days on their feet, walking long distances, and operating heavy machinery. Therefore, physical fitness, strength, and stamina are essential for this role.

Moreover, lumpers must be comfortable working in various environments. They might be exposed to extreme temperatures, inclement weather, and hazardous materials. As such, they need to be adaptable and resilient, able to handle the physical challenges that come with the job.

Required Skills and Qualities

While physical prowess is crucial, lumpers also need a specific set of skills and qualities to excel in their role. These include:

  • Attention to Detail: Lumpers must be meticulous, ensuring that goods are handled with care and that inventory is accurately tracked.
  • Problem-Solving Skills: They should be able to think on their feet, troubleshooting issues that may arise during the loading/unloading process.
  • Teamwork: Lumpers often work in teams, so the ability to collaborate and communicate effectively is vital.
  • Safety Awareness: They must prioritize safety, following protocols to prevent accidents and injuries.

The Benefits of a Career in Lumping

Despite the physical demands, a career in lumping offers numerous benefits. For starters, it provides immediate employment opportunities, with many companies offering on-the-spot hiring. It's also an excellent entry point into the logistics industry, offering a chance to learn the ropes and potentially advance to supervisory or management roles.

Moreover, lumping jobs often come with competitive pay and benefits packages, including health insurance, retirement plans, and bonuses. They also offer flexible scheduling, with many positions providing full-time hours and overtime opportunities.

Career Growth Opportunities

While lumping is often seen as an entry-level position, there are ample opportunities for career growth. With experience and demonstrated skills, lumpers can advance to roles like warehouse supervisor, operations manager, or even logistics director. Some may also choose to specialize in a particular area, such as hazardous materials handling or cold storage.

Furthermore, the logistics industry is vast and ever-growing. This means that lumpers can explore different sectors, from manufacturing and retail to healthcare and e-commerce, each offering its unique challenges and rewards.
